The Las Vegas Raiders are in the first year of the Pete Carroll and John Spytek era, so there is still a bit of experimenting to do. The roster had tons of turnover this offseason, and unlike past regimes, this tandem is trying to build a long-term winner instead of patching up the team every offseason.
This means that an abundance of younger players are in the building, and there are only a handful of high-dollar veterans like Maxx Crosby or Geno Smith. The rest are simply cheap additions or reclamation projects that the team is not tied to on a long-term deal.
